On March 31, Jagex officially announced its next game, RuneScape: Dragonwilds. At the time, it confirmed that it would launch into Early Access in Spring 2025 with no exact date. Well, that date is today, as the crafting survival game is now available on Steam Early Access. Set on the continent of Ashenfall in the RuneScape universe, RuneScape: Dragonwilds is a co-op survival adventure built using Unreal Engine 5.

Along with launching into Early Access, the team has shared a roadmap for the game’s development. Players can expect a new region to come called Fellhollow, which will be home to a new dragon overlord, The Soul-Eater Imaru. The rest is pretty standard fare for a crafting survival game, including more skills, quests, lore, gear, enemies, expanded base building, and more. RuneScape: Dragonwilds will also add a hardcore mode and a creative mode, catering to two very different player types.

The game’s surprise launch means it wasn’t really on anyone’s radar for April. With the recent announcement that Dune: Awakening has been delayed, RuneScape: Dragonwilds couldn’t have chosen a better day to shadow drop.
